Md. Code Regs. 22.03.04.05 - Retirement Agency Notices

A. Unless otherwise provided, a notice that the Retirement Agency must mail or file under this subtitle shall be:
(1) Made in writing; and
(2) Sent to the claimant at the claimant's address on file at the Retirement Agency by:
(a) First class mail, postage prepaid, or
(b) Personal delivery.
B. Whenever a claimant is required to take some action or make an election within a required period after the date of the notice, 3 days shall be added to the required period, if delivery of the notice is made by first class mail.
